1. Utilize Strong Passwords and Authentication Methods

The foundation of device privacy starts with robust passwords. Here are some tips to strengthen your password strategy:

  • Create complex passwords: Use a mix of upper and lower case letters, numbers, and special characters.
  • Implement two-factor authentication: This adds an extra layer of security by requiring a second form of verification.
  • Use a password manager: This tool helps you generate and store strong passwords securely.

2. Keep Software Updated

Regular software updates are critical for maintaining device privacy. Updates often include essential security patches that protect your device from vulnerabilities. Here’s how to ensure your software is always current:

  1. Enable automatic updates on your devices.
  2. Regularly check for updates on applications and operating systems.
  3. Stay informed about new vulnerabilities and threats to your specific devices.

3. Use VPNs for Secure Browsing

A Virtual Private Network (VPN) encrypts your internet connection, making it more difficult for hackers and third parties to access your data. Consider the following when using a VPN:

  • Choose a reputable VPN service: Research and select a VPN with a strong privacy policy and positive reviews.
  • Ensure no-logs policy: Opt for a VPN that does not keep records of your online activities.

4. Manage App Permissions

Many apps request access to more information than they need. To enhance your device privacy:

  • Review app permissions: Regularly check and adjust permissions for each app installed on your device.
  • Limit location access: Only allow location services when necessary, and prefer "While Using" over "Always."
  • Uninstall unnecessary apps: Remove apps that no longer serve a purpose or that you don’t trust.

5. Enable Device Encryption

Encrypting your device adds an essential layer of security. This process makes your data unreadable without the correct password or key. To ensure your device is encrypted:

  • Check your device settings: Most modern operating systems offer encryption options that can be easily enabled.
  • Backup your data: Regular backups ensure you won’t lose important information during the encryption process.

6. Be Cautious with Public Wi-Fi

Using public Wi-Fi can expose your data to risks. To protect your device privacy while connected to public networks:

  • Avoid sensitive transactions: Don’t access banking or personal accounts over public Wi-Fi.
  • Use a VPN: Always connect to a VPN when using public networks.
